Fans kicked out of Hong Kong’s Kai Tak Arena early at World Snooker Grand Prix

Andrew Cesare Richardson

5 Mar 2025

Kyren Wilson’s thrilling match with Matthew Selt briefly stopped to allow supporters to leave the venue

Kai Tak Sports Park bosses kicked hundreds of snooker fans out of the World Grand Prix mid-way through Kyren Wilson’s late-night clash with Matthew Selt on Tuesday, because they said it was time for them to go home.

Officials had instituted a midnight curfew for the venue to coincide with public transport stopping for the night, and would not change their minds

The World Snooker Tour said spectators had been “required to leave early before the match concluded”.
